Italian

[edit]

Alternative forms

[edit]

Etymology

[edit]

    Borrowed from Latin dēnotāre.

    Pronunciation

    [edit]
    • IPA(key): /de.noˈta.re/
    • Rhymes: -are
    • Hyphenation: de‧no‧tà‧re

    Verb

    [edit]

    denotàre (first-person singular present denòto, first-person singular past historic denotài, past participle denotàto, auxiliary avére)

    1. (transitive) to indicate, denote
